One in Three Athenians Travel Daily by Bus
Buses are the most preferred means of transport for Athens residents, according to a new survey that shows that one in three Athenians takes the bus on a daily basis.

Greeks Are the Unhappiest Citizens in Europe
According to a recent survey conducted by the Hellenic Statistical Authority (ELSTAT) in collaboration with the Eurobarometer, Greeks are the unhappiest European Union citizens.
